James Lois McGill, 86 of North Zulch, Texas passed away on Wednesday, August 20, 2008 at St. Joseph Regional Health Center. Funeral services are set for 11:00 am, Saturday, August 23, at Madisonville Funeral Home. Interment will follow at Willowhole Cemetery in North Zulch. Pallbearers are Mike, Chris, Jason & Zachary Norman, David Lawson and Charles Drake. Honorary pallbearers are Joseph Dalzell, Noah & Ethan Norman. Visitation is scheduled for Friday, August 22, 2008, from 12 noon until 8 p.m. James was born November 19, 1921 to George W. and Lou Emma (Baines) McGill. He was preceded in death by his parents and three brothers. He served in the US Army during WW II from 1-28-43 until 4-16-46. James worked for Madison County as a county laborer. He was a member of the North Zulch Free Will Baptist Church and was baptized on December 8, 1957. He served as deacon since 1961. He was a life member of the VFW Post #8233. And he graduated from North Zulch High School with a honorary diploma on November 9, 2000. His favorite passages from the Bible are, the 23rd Psalm and I Thessalonians 4:13-18. Survivors include his wife of 61 years, Doris; three daughters, Billie Sue and husband, Charlie Norman of Houston, Bertha Jo and husband, Wilmer Lawson of North Zulch and Anissa Gail and husband, John Dalzell of Navasota; six grandchildren, Mike Norman of Pearland, Chris Norman of Pearland, Wendy Drake of North Zulch, David Lawson of San Antonio, Jason Norman of Houston and Joseph Dalzell of Navasota; great grandchildren, Zachary, Makalah & Noah Norman of Pearland, Haley & Alicia Norman of Pearland, Ethan Norman of Houston, Keeli & Cori Drake of North Zulch and Skyler Lawson of San Antonio.
